I had NO idea that Clinton is the FIRST Sec. of State to visit Ireland.
According to www.IrishCentral.com

http://www.irishcentral.com/news/Hillary-Clinton-pushes-hard-for-Irish-deal-63992867.html

It was the first leg of her dedicated visit to Ireland, North and South, the first ever by a Secretary of State.

Everywhere she went in public, Clinton, a hugely popular figure in Ireland, was greeted with applause and a hearty Irish welcome. She met with Taoiseach (Irish Prime Minister) Brian Cowen and President Mary McAleese and discussed the situation of Irish undocumented in the U.S. as well as Northern Ireland and global economic issues.
